Dusky-chested Flycatcher vs Plains Pocket Mouse
Myiozetetes luteiventris compared with Perognathus flavescens
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Dusky-chested Flycatcher | Plains Pocket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Tyrannidae | Heteromyidae |
| Genus | Myiozetetes | Perognathus |
| Species | Myiozetetes luteiventris | Perognathus flavescens |
Evolutionary Relationship
Dusky-chested Flycatcher and Plains Pocket Mouse share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
